If you run out of vacation or leave days, will you have enough savings to make it? Would you want to borrow money from family or friends while you’re getting well? Obtaining Social Security disability bene ts can be challenging and time consuming. The Longshoremen are making voluntary short- term disability income insurance available to you. You must satisfy the income requirements to qualify.
Waiting Period and Bene t Durations
Option 1 - 14 days after a sickness or accident, 6 month duration
Option 2 - 30 days after a sickness or accident, 12 month duration
Option 3 - 30 days after a sickness or accident, 24 month duration
Monthly Bene t:
An amount between $1,200 and $5,000 (in $100 increments), not to exceed 60% of your monthly income.

Top Reasons to offer the Longshoremen Disability Income Insurance Program
1) To Be Eligible for ILA Disability Retirement Bene ts You Must Meet Certain Criteria
You are entitled to apply for a disability bene t from the Plan if all of the following requirements are met:
• You are totally and permanently disabled.
• Your disability occurs after you have reached age 40 and have completed 15 full or one-half years of Bene t Service.
• You are not a “vested terminated participant*”.
• The Trustees receive satisfactory proof of your disability.
*A Participant who incurs one or more breaks in service as a result of illness which began before the Participant attained age 40 and while the Participant was employed in the industry shall not be a vested terminated participant by reason of the breaks in service.
2) Coverage for Partial Disabilities is Limited
In addition to other eligibility conditions for ILA and SSDI total disability retirement bene ts, you must be unable to perform the critical or essential elements of your position. This means that if you are able to perform some, but not all, of the critical or essential elements of your position, you may be ineligible for bene ts. Although each claim must be evaluated individually, in many instances, a claimant under the Longshoremen Disability Income Program will be able to obtain disability income bene ts even if he or she is still able to perform some of the critical or essential elements of his or herposition.
3) Income Replacement Bene ts are NOT Taxable1
The disability income bene ts provided by the Longshoremen Disability Income Insurance plan are not taxable to a member, which means a greater amount of income replacement for members when they need it most.
